To this date, the imposing scale model of the ruins of Pompeii, preserved at the National Archaeological Museum of Naples, has not received the adequate consideration of its intrinsic value as a historical and archaeological document. At the origin of the creation of the model there were not only well defined cultural reasons, but also the strong desire to promote a more immediate understanding of the entire site of Pompeii and to document, with meticulousness and skill, the state of conservation closely following the phases of rediscovery. The Great Imitation of Pompeii, as a precious and extraordinary document, continues to show us even today the original decoration and planivolumetric articulation of the monumental remains. The complete digitalization of the Great Scale Model not only provides a 3D copy of the original, but also an indispensable research and communication tool: it preserves and amplifies the documentary value of the original. In an uninterrupted game of reflections, cross-references, correspondences between archaeological reality, physical model and its digital replica, the Atlas returns to the Great Scale Model of Pompei the place it deserves in the history of archaeological research.
